Unveiling the Powerhouse: Odyssey OLED G9 Specs

The Samsung Odyssey OLED G9 doesn't just impress; it dazzles. Boasting a 49-inch OLED display with a curvature of 1,800R, it promises an immersive viewing experience that's hard to beat. The inclusion of a 240Hz refresh rate coupled with a 0.03ms response time means that every frame is rendered with precision, keeping you ahead in high-stakes gaming scenarios. With a resolution of 5120 x 1440 and a 32:9 aspect ratio, it stretches the boundaries of your visual playground.

Why It's a Win for Gamers

The Samsung Odyssey OLED G9 elevates gaming sessions by supporting AMD FreeSync Premium, ensuring seamless, fluid gameplay devoid of screen tearing. The almost ludicrous aspect ratio offers a wide panoramic view, bringing games to life in ways you've never seen before. Whether racing across the horizon in Forza Horizon 5 or battling demons in Doom: Eternal, the expansive display engulfs you into the worlds like never before.
